Delilah has fantastic insurance, but I later found out her policy doesn’t cover CCL surgery in the first year. This was a sudden expense ( including all the meds leading up to surgery). I'm single and on a single income.

Delilah tore the cranial cruciate ligament (CCL) in her rear left leg. Surgery was the only option. She’s scheduled to go in on March 1 at Providence River Animal Hospital. She’ll have a 4” incision going down her knee and will be required to wear a cone for a month. Recovery is about 2-3 months. She’s on trazodone, gabapentin and carprofen. Carfrofen makes her sick so she takes Prilosec.
